The 'ceph health' Nagios plugin will monitor the health of your ceph cluster. The plugin allows to specify a client user id and keyring to execute the plugin as user 'nagios' (or other)

Ceph health Nagios plugin =========================
Usage -----
usage: check_ceph_health [-h] [-e EXE] [-c CONF] [-m MONADDRESS] [-i ID] [-k KEYRING] [-d]
'ceph health' nagios plugin.
optional arguments: -h, --help show this help message and exit -e EXE, --exe EXE ceph executable [/usr/bin/ceph] -c CONF, --conf CONF alternative ceph conf file -m MONADDRESS, --monaddress MONADDRESS ceph monitor address[:port] -i ID, --id ID ceph client id -k KEYRING, --keyring KEYRING ceph client keyring file -d, --detail exec 'ceph health detail'
Example -------
nagios$ ./check_ceph_health --id nagios --keyring client.nagios.keyring HEALTH WARNING: 1 pgs degraded; 1 pgs recovering; 1 pgs stuck unclean; recovery 4448/28924462 degraded (0.015%); 2/9857830 unfound (0.000%); nagios$ echo $? 1
